加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.ijishu.cn/)- CDN、边缘计算、物联网、云计算、开发!
当前位置: 首页 > 运营中心 > 建站资源 > 优化 > 正文

UI测试工程师视角:建站效能提速全攻略

发布时间:2026-04-07 09:50:48 所属栏目:优化 来源:DaWei
导读:  在数字化浪潮中,网站建设效率直接影响产品迭代速度与市场竞争力。作为UI测试工程师,我们的核心使命不仅是保障界面质量,更要通过优化测试流程、提升协作效率,推动建站效能全面提速。本文将从测试策略、工具链

  在数字化浪潮中,网站建设效率直接影响产品迭代速度与市场竞争力。作为UI测试工程师,我们的核心使命不仅是保障界面质量,更要通过优化测试流程、提升协作效率,推动建站效能全面提速。本文将从测试策略、工具链整合、自动化实施、数据驱动及团队协作五大维度,分享实战经验,助力团队突破效能瓶颈。


  一、精准定位测试范围,避免无效投入
传统全量回归测试耗时耗力,且难以聚焦核心场景。UI测试工程师需结合产品特性与用户行为数据,制定分层测试策略:对高频交互模块(如登录、支付)实施全量覆盖;对低频功能(如帮助中心)采用抽样测试;对静态页面(如品牌宣传页)仅验证关键元素。例如,某电商网站改版后,通过分析用户访问路径,将测试重点从全站1200个页面缩减至300个核心页面,测试周期缩短65%,同时缺陷检出率提升20%。


  二、构建一体化工具链,消除流程断点
工具分散是效能损耗的主因之一。推荐采用“设计-开发-测试”全链路工具整合方案:
1. 设计阶段:使用Figma或Sketch插件自动生成UI规范文档,同步至测试管理平台;

2. 开发阶段:通过Jenkins/GitLab CI集成代码提交触发UI自动化测试,结合Allure生成可视化报告;

3. 测试阶段:部署Selenium Grid+BrowserStack实现跨浏览器/设备并行测试,搭配Charles抓包工具快速定位接口问题;

4. 交付阶段:利用Jira与Confluence联动,将缺陷修复流程嵌入知识库,减少重复沟通成本。某金融科技团队通过此方案,将单次迭代测试周期从5天压缩至2天,人工操作减少80%。


  三、推进自动化测试的“精准化”落地
自动化不是万能药,需遵循“二八原则”:
- 场景选择:优先自动化高频、稳定的流程(如表单提交、导航跳转),避免动态内容(如广告位)或复杂交互(如拖拽排序);

AI提供的信息图,仅供参考

- 脚本维护:采用Page Object模式封装页面元素,结合Cucumber编写可读性强的测试用例,降低维护成本;
- 智能等待:引入显式等待替代硬编码延迟,解决异步加载导致的测试不稳定问题。某社交平台通过优化自动化脚本,将测试执行时间从3小时缩短至40分钟,脚本复用率提升至90%。


  四、以数据驱动测试决策
建立测试效能看板,实时监控关键指标:
- 覆盖率:通过Jacoco/Istanbul统计代码覆盖率,结合Sentry错误监控补充用户侧数据;
- 稳定性:分析自动化测试失败原因,区分“真实缺陷”与“环境/脚本问题”;
- 投入产出比:计算自动化测试节省的人力成本与脚本开发成本的平衡点。某物流系统团队通过数据看板发现,某模块的自动化测试维护成本超过手动测试,果断调整策略,整体效能提升35%。


  五、打造“测试左移”的协作文化
效能提升需突破部门墙:
- 需求阶段:参与PRD评审,从测试视角提出可测性设计建议(如唯一ID、数据隔离);
- 开发阶段:推行“结对测试”,与开发共同编写单元测试,提前拦截80%基础缺陷;
- 上线阶段:实施灰度发布+A/B测试,通过埋点数据验证功能效果,减少全量回滚风险。某在线教育平台通过测试左移,将缺陷发现阶段前移至需求设计阶段,缺陷修复成本降低90%。


  建站效能提速是一场“质量+效率”的双重变革。UI测试工程师需以技术为矛,以流程为盾,通过精准测试、智能工具、数据洞察与跨团队协作,构建可持续的效能提升体系。记住:效能提升不是追求绝对速度,而是让每一分钟投入都产生最大价值。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章